SOUTH AFRICAN FIRMS’ PROPENSITY TO PAY DIVIDENDS AND THE ALTERNATIVES THEREOF
1. INTRODUCTION
In this paper the theory on dividends and its alternatives was applied to firms in the South African economy. Firstly, the theory behind dividend payments, the propensity of firms to pay dividends and the alternatives to dividends were discussed. An analysis was then undertaken to examine the trend of the dividends being paid in eight sectors of the South African economy and the economy as a whole. The sectors studied were Hotel and Leisure, Manufacturing, Retail, Industrial Transportation, Banking, Construction and Materials, Beverage and Mining and Minerals
